MOVIE SCORES - TOP 10 - movielover86

"movielover86" sur YouTube défend son Top 10 de musiques de films:

Edward Scissorhands is a beautiful peice of music, and it is as magical as it is haunting

The Nightmare Before Christmas is fun and zany with a variety of different themes, and they're all just great.

Revenge of the Sith is my favorite Star Wars movie, mostly because of the score. It includes all of the music from the earlier movies and new themes, and it's just epic.

The Rock is intense and fun. It's the best action movie and I can easily listen to this score whenever I play an action packed game, and have the most fun. I love the score from the Rock.

Titanic is just beautiful. It won the oscar for Pete's sake.

Jurassic Park is just gorgeous. The flow from note to note exceedes any other John Williams peices.

True Romance has the happiest soundtrack than any other movie. Bar none.

Braveheart has gotten no backlash, so no explanation is needed for that.

The Fellowship of the Ring has my favorite score from the other Lord of the RIngs mostly because it can be small and beautiful, and then go to extreme and epic, and that was important for this movie, so this had the best for the Lord of the Rings movies.

Road to Perdition, my number one, has the best score ever. It doesn't have one uninteresting score. It's all amazingly beautiful and doesn't have just one theme. If anyone disagees with me, you haven't listened to the score.
